logo

Output 58a608362fded4cc12a39da89ea03c7e8d9d6b0023091c41b5eaed749b29681b:0

value
90750844
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54967afa30aa1096831ebe45f1a3102a6e3efd8a OP_EQUALVERIFY OP_CHECKSIG
address
18iG2g5shuqTB3p4613QcJiJtWQNurNSmA
transaction
58a608362fded4cc12a39da89ea03c7e8d9d6b0023091c41b5eaed749b29681b